Carnitine Synthesis and Dietary Uptake In animal tissues, L-carnitine concentrations are relatively high, typically between 0.2 and 6 mmol/kg with almost all in the heart and skeletal muscle, and it is synthesised de novo in animal cells by a multi-step process with N -trimethyl-lysine derived from protein degradation as the primary precursor and butyrobetaine as an intermediate
